PDF Write a Label - Canadian Museum of History Identification labels (museums sometimes call them tombstone labels): provide the most basic information about the artifact, usually the name, age, place of manufacture, museum owning it, and artifact number. These are written in point form.

Guidelines for Making Wall Labels for Your Art Exhibition Labels used to be a lot smaller—think business-card-sized—until studies showed that they were hard to read. Make the font size at least 14 points. Larger is better when you want the majority of your audience to be able to read the labels. No need for large margins around the text on a label. Museum labels template. Resources | Writing Exhibit Labels | Gaylord Archival Text for exhibit labels should be friendly, but still speak with authority. Labels with a combination of text and graphics have found to be more meaningful and memorable to visitors. Including visual references encourages visitors to interact and discuss the object on display. Explain technical terms but avoid jargon and confusing acronyms. Museum label - Wikipedia A museum label, also referred to as a caption or tombstone, is a label describing an object exhibited in a museum or one introducing a room or area. Museum labels tend to list the artist's name, the artwork's name, the year the art was completed, and the materials used. They may also include a summary, description, the years the artist lived, and the dimensions of the work.

Writing Text and Labels - The Australian Museum Provide strong contrast between type and background. Set body copy in 24-point type or larger. Use line lengths of 50 to 60 characters. Limit labels to a maximum of 50 words (if longer, break into two or three smaller labels). Use both uppercase and lowercase letters in the body copy. How to make Art Gallery Labels in a day like a Pro Apply the back of the label to the sticky side of the JAC paper, rubbing gently to remove air bubbles. 5. Cut a piece of cardboard or Fome-Cor to the same size. 6. Peel the protective backing off the other side of the JAC paper and apply it to the cardboard or Fome-Cor. 7. Use a craft knife and ruler to trim the label along the pencil marks.

Writing Labels & Gallery Text - V&A Blog Each object label will provide at a minimum what is known as 'tomb-stone' information - short factual information about the object and its creation. This includes categories such as: What it is Where, when and by whom it was made The materials and techniques used to make it Any inscriptions on it Its museum number
